I am nominating Chelsea for the DAISY Award because her compassion, patience, and dedication transformed one of the most difficult experiences of my life into something manageable, hopeful, and humane. Chelsea is not just an excellent nurse—she is a truly extraordinary human being. From the moment she entered the room, she brought calm, warmth, and reassurance. She treated my wife and me with genuine kindness, listening carefully to our concerns, never rushing us, and always making sure we understood what was happening. In a situation that was filled with fear, uncertainty, and physical and emotional pain, Chelsea became a steady source of comfort. What stood out most was the way she cared, not just that she cared. She spoke to my wife with dignity and respect, even in her most vulnerable moments. She encouraged her, advocated for her, checked on her frequently, and made sure she was safe and comfortable. She noticed the little things—like when she was in pain before she even said anything, or when she needed repositioning or reassurance. These may seem small, but they made a world of difference. Chelsea also supported me. She recognized how heavy everything felt and took time to explain each update, each medication, and each step of the plan of care. She treated me like a partner, not an outsider watching helplessly. That meant more than she knows. In a hospital environment where nurses are constantly stretched thin, Chelsea never let it show. She carried herself with professionalism, empathy, and a level of compassion that goes far beyond the job description. It is clear that nursing is not just her profession — it is her calling. Chelsea exemplifies everything the DAISY Award stands for: • Compassion • Exceptional clinical care • Human connection • Dedication to patient and family well-being.  For these reasons and more, I wholeheartedly nominate Chelsea for the DAISY Award. She made an extraordinary impact on us, and she deserves to be recognized for the outstanding nurse — and person — she is.
